What is Alargin?

Alargin is a non-prescription, over-the-counter pain relief tablet that combines several active ingredients to tackle mild to moderate pain. You might’ve seen it in your local pharmacy next to other analgesics. It’s similar to some common painkillers, but with its own twist Alargin often includes a mild muscle relaxant component that helps with tension headaches or minor muscular aches. Lots of folks choose it because it works relatively fast and typically doesn’t upset the stomach as much as other NSAIDs (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s).

Its important to note that while widely used, Alargin isn’t a miracle pill so don’t go chugging half a bottle expecting instant oblivion of pain. Always stick to the directions and check with your healthcare provider if you’re unsure.

How to Use Alargin Tablets

Alright, so you’ve got your pack of Alargin now what? We’ll cover dosage, timing, and some handy tips to maximize absorption. No fluff, just practical info.

Dosage Instructions

Standard adult dosing usually goes like this:

  • 1–2 tablets every 6–8 hours
  • Do not exceed 8 tablets in 24 hours
  • For those over 65, start low maybe just 1 tablet per dose

Kids under 12 should avoid Alargin unless directed by a pediatrician. And don’t mix with other NSAIDs (like ibuprofen or diclofenac) at the same time—you’re just upping the risk of side effects without extra benefit.

Ingredients In Alargin Tablets

Let’s peek under the hood. While the exact proprietary blend can vary by manufacturer or region, most Alargin tablets share similar active ingredients.

Active Ingredients

  • Ibuprofen (200 mg) – classic NSAID that fights pain and swelling
  • Paracetamol (Acetaminophen) (325 mg) – works centrally in the brain to reduce discomfort
  • Caffeine (30 mg) – boosts the pain relief effect and reduces fatigue
  • Muscle Relaxant (e.g., Methocarbamol 150 mg) – eases muscle spasms

Together, these ingredients attack pain from multiple angles. Prostaglandins in the peripheral tissues, central processing in the brain, and muscle tension all get targeted. It’s almost like assembling a pain-relief superhero team!

Excipients and Other Compounds

Besides the “active squad,” tablets contain:

  • Binders: microcrystalline cellulose
  • Disintegrants: croscarmellose sodium
  • Lubricants: magnesium stearate
  • Coating agents: hypromellose, titanium dioxide

These help the tablet hold together, dissolve properly in your GI tract, and look pretty though the coating doesn’t add to the therapeutic effect.

Side Effects and Precautions

No medicine is risk-free. Let’s be real about possible downsides of Alargin. Some folks breeze through with no issues; others might run into mild or even serious reactions.

Common Side Effects

  • Stomach pain or mild dyspepsia
  • Nausea or occasional vomiting
  • Dizziness or lightheadedness
  • Headache

Most of these go away if you take Alargin with food. But if you feel really uncomfortable, skip the next dose and see how you feel.

Serious Adverse Reactions and When to See a Doctor

Though rare, watch out for:

  • Black or bloody stools
  • Severe stomach pain or signs of a stomach ulcer
  • Allergic reactions: rash, itching, swelling
  • Difficulty breathing or chest tightness
  • Sudden changes in urination

If you notice any of these, stop taking Alargin immediately and get medical help. And hey, if you’re pregnant, breastfeeding, or have pre-existing kidney or liver issues, chat with your doc first. Taking more than the recommended dose can also lead to overdose symptoms like confusion, rapid heartbeat, or even seizures.
